£69.50The Blue and the Gray (Civil War Suite) - Clare Grundman
Published in 1961 commemorating the start of the Civil War 100 years before, Clare Grundman's classic work has become a staple in the repertoire. Robert Longfield's adaptation for younger bands maintains the character of the original as well as all of the tunes, but in a shorter and more concise setting.

£82.95The Blue Ridge - Robert Sheldon
The Blue Ridge Mountains have a rich history of folk music handed down by the families of the settlers in this region. Four of these wonderful songs have been included in this setting for concert band: the spirited "Jack-a-Roe," the haunting "Come All Ye Fair and Tender Ladies," the very popular "Tom Dooley" (arranged here in a most unexpected manner), and finally, the beautiful "Barbara Allen." (6:15)
